The Republic of Texas was an independent nation that existed from 1836 to 1845. It was formed after the Texas Revolution, which resulted in Texas gaining independence from Mexico. The Republic of Texas was eventually annexed by the United States in 1845.

Secession is the withdrawal of a group of people from a larger political unit, such as a state or a country. Secession can be a peaceful or a violent process, and it can be motivated by a variety of factors, such as political, economic, or cultural differences.

  • The Right to Secede

    The right to secede is a controversial topic. Some people argue that secession is always wrong, while others argue that it is sometimes justified. There are a number of factors that can be considered when evaluating the legitimacy of a secession movement, such as the level of support for secession within the seceding group, the reasons for secession, and the potential consequences of secession.

  • Historical Examples of Secession

    There are many examples of secession throughout history. Some of the most famous examples include the secession of the United States from Great Britain in 1776, the secession of the Confederate States of America from the United States in 1861, and the secession of South Sudan from Sudan in 2011.
